About the Exhibition

Just Us is an exhibition of original artwork created by artists at State Correctional Institution (SCI) Phoenix, southeast Pennsylvania’s maximum-security prison for men, and artists from Mural Arts Philadelphia’s Rec Crew, a job readiness and life skills program for justice-impacted young adults. Throughout the spring, Rec Crew members participated in art education classes in the Barnes collection while Barnes instructors visited artists at SCI Phoenix to discuss the exhibition.

As the United States marks its 250th anniversary, Just Us reflects on the past, present, and future of the American experiment through the unique perspectives of these artists. Works consider the power of memory, celebrate heritage and community, and explore the resilience of hope while confronting the nation’s struggles and still-unrealized aspirations. With voices bold and subtle, Just Us speaks to our present moment and encourages viewers to dream of a better tomorrow.

On view in the first-floor classroom of the Collection Gallery.
